Приветствую, друзья! Сегодня в продолжение статьи о FUPE основах поговорим про FUPE блоки для EVM. Расскажем про FUPE-Gas, много-кластерный EVM и приведем несколько примеров. Enjoy!
FUPE
FUPE дает возможность реализовать динамический конструктор ядер с различными параметрами (адекватными под задачи AlGas). Например, один газ потребует машину с памятью 1 Кб, а другой – 1 Мб. Или машины с разной производительностью.
gVM машины, сгенерированные под разные параметры FUPE.
Так мы приходим к тому, что сам процесс генерации машин становится функцией AlGas. Т.е. сама генерация различных машин трактуется по разной себестоимости.
FUPE-Gas
Введем понятие FUPE-Gas:
– Генерация gVM машин из FUPE блоков, которая учитывается через KANT.fupe газ. Этот газ идет на выплаты создателям FUPE блоков для gVM машин.
Какие динамические параметры машин и FUPE блоков можно рассматривать?
Как пример:
- Размер оперативной памяти (Mem)
- Размер Boot
- Наличие интерфейса для работы с данными (потоками данных)
- Наличие Trace
- Количество файлов регистров и их объем
- Размер и количество TLB
- Наличие операционной системы (+ выбор типа)
Много-кластерный EVM
GONT использует подход многокластерности EVM для логического разделения бизнес-юнитов. Например, для одновременной поддержки одной EVM бинарных кодов от различных блокчейнов.
**Пример многокластерности: **
При этом «старый» EVM Ethereum функционально эквивалентно отображается на один из кластеров. Т.е. GONT VM расширяет EVM путем кластерного подхода.
Вывод
Мы задаем параметрическую сборку ядер из элементов FUPE пространства.
Спасибо за внимание! Оставайтесь на связи.
GONT
@ilya-gont Поздравляю! Вы получили личную награду!
С Днём Рождения - 1 год на Голосе
Вы можете нажать на бейдж, чтобы увидеть свою страницу на Доске Почета.
@ilya-gont, поздравляю! Вы добились некоторого прогресса на Голосе и были награждены следующими новыми бейджами:
Награда за количество опубликованных постов
Вы можете нажать на бейдж, чтобы увидеть свою страницу на Доске Почета.
Если вы больше не хотите получать уведомления, ответьте на этот комментарий словом
стоп